Clinica Chimica Acta | 1968
Tohru Inouye; Henry L. Nadler; David Yi-Yung Hsia
Abstract The assay of galactose-1-phosphate uridyltransferase (E.C. 2.7.7.12: UDP-glucose: α- d -galactose-1-phosphate uridyltransferase) in red and white cells of blood is reported using [14C]galactose-1-phosphate and UDPglucose as substrates and measuring the 14C activity in the nucleotides. The reaction requires for optimal activity a concentration of 3.2 mM galactose-1-phosphate and 1.6 mM UDPG with the pH maintained at 8.40.
American Journal of Obstetrics and Gynecology | 1973
Tohru Inouye; John I. Brewer
Abstract Gonadotropin from patients with choriocarcinoma was investigated to find means to regain biological activity which was lost during and after purification by diethylaminoethyl-cellulose chromatography. The loss was not due to changes in the content of N-acetyl neuraminic acid. Regain of biological activity as tested by the mouse uterine weight gain method was effected by incubating the gonadotropin in 20 mM sodium phosphate buffer at pH 7.2 containing 3.5 mM sodium dodecyl sulfate, 25 mM oxidized glutathione, and 6.0 mM ethylenediamine tetra-acetate for 24 hours at 37°C. The regain was 50- to 85-fold. The possible mechanisms are discussed.
